编程培训机构为什么没有C
-
编程培训机构为什么没有C
C语言作为一门经典的编程语言,被广泛应用于系统软件、嵌入式开发以及高性能计算等领域。然而,在一些编程培训机构中,我们往往发现C语言的课程相对较少,甚至没有。这其中的原因有以下几点:
-
市场需求:随着技术的不断发展,编程语言也在不断更新迭代,新兴的编程语言如Python、JavaScript等在市场上受到了更多的关注和需求。相比之下,C语言的需求相对较少,因为C语言更多地应用于底层开发和系统编程,而这些领域的需求相对较为专业和有限。
-
学习曲线陡峭:相比一些高级语言而言,C语言的学习曲线相对较陡峭。C语言需要掌握的概念和语法相对复杂,对于初学者来说可能会有一定的挑战。而编程培训机构通常更倾向于提供一些入门级的课程,以满足大多数学员的需求。
-
专业性较强:C语言作为一门系统编程语言,更多地应用于底层开发和系统调优等领域。相对于一些应用开发领域,这些领域对学员的要求更高,需要更多的实践和专业知识。因此,编程培训机构可能更倾向于提供一些更广泛适用、学习门槛较低的编程语言课程。
尽管如此,C语言作为一门经典的编程语言,仍然具有重要的地位和价值。对于一些对底层开发、系统调优有兴趣的学员来说,深入学习C语言仍然是非常有意义的。对于那些想要从事系统软件、嵌入式开发等领域的人来说,熟练掌握C语言也是必不可少的技能。因此,对于一些专业性较强的编程培训机构,他们可能会提供C语言的课程,以满足这部分学员的需求。
综上所述,编程培训机构为什么没有C语言的课程,主要是因为市场需求较少、学习曲线陡峭以及专业性较强等原因。然而,C语言作为一门经典的编程语言仍然具有重要的地位和价值,对于一些特定领域的学员来说,深入学习C语言仍然是非常有意义的。
1年前 -
-
编程培训机构没有C语言课程可能有以下几个原因:
-
需求不高:C语言虽然是一门重要的编程语言,但它在当前的技术领域中的需求相对较低。随着计算机科学的发展,出现了更加高级的编程语言,如Java、Python等,这些语言更加易学易用,并且能够满足更多的编程需求。因此,对于编程培训机构来说,开设C语言课程可能并不是一个具有吸引力的选择。
-
学习曲线陡峭:C语言是一门相对底层的编程语言,需要对计算机的底层原理有一定的了解。相对于其他更高级的编程语言,学习C语言需要更多的时间和精力。对于一些初学者来说,学习C语言可能会有一定的难度,因此编程培训机构可能更倾向于开设更容易上手的编程语言课程。
-
市场竞争激烈:编程培训机构市场竞争激烈,为了吸引更多的学生,他们往往会选择开设热门的编程语言课程,如Java、Python等。这些编程语言具有更广泛的应用领域和更高的就业前景,因此更受学生和企业的青睐。相比之下,C语言的市场需求相对较低,因此编程培训机构可能不愿意投入资源开设C语言课程。
-
自学资源丰富:C语言作为一门历史悠久的编程语言,有大量的教材、教程和在线资源可供学习。相对于其他编程语言,学习C语言的自学资源更加丰富,学生可以通过自学的方式掌握C语言的基本知识和技能。因此,编程培训机构可能认为学生可以通过自学来掌握C语言,从而选择不开设相关课程。
-
专业化需求:C语言在某些特定领域仍然有一定的应用,比如嵌入式系统开发、驱动程序开发等。针对这些特定领域的学生,可能更倾向于选择专门的培训机构或者专业的教育机构来学习C语言。因此,普通的编程培训机构可能认为在自己的课程中不开设C语言课程是一个更合适的选择。
1年前 -
-
编程培训机构通常没有C语言的教学课程,这可能是由于以下几个原因:
-
编程语言的流行度:随着时间的推移,编程语言的流行度也会发生变化。C语言作为一种较早的编程语言,在现代编程中逐渐被更高级的语言所替代,如Java、Python和C++等。相比之下,这些语言更易学、更易用,同时也拥有更广泛的应用领域。因此,编程培训机构更倾向于教授这些更受欢迎的编程语言,以满足学员的需求。
-
就业市场需求:编程培训机构通常会根据就业市场的需求来设计他们的课程。C语言虽然在一些特定的领域(如嵌入式系统开发)仍然有应用,但相对于其他语言,C语言的就业机会相对较少。因此,编程培训机构更倾向于教授那些在就业市场上需求量更大的语言,以提高学员的就业竞争力。
-
学习难度和学习曲线:相比于其他高级语言,C语言的学习曲线较陡峭,对于初学者来说可能会有一定的挑战。编程培训机构通常会选择那些更易学的语言作为入门课程,以帮助学员建立编程的基础知识和技能。在学员掌握了基础知识后,他们可以选择进一步学习C语言或其他更高级的编程语言。
尽管编程培训机构通常不提供C语言的教学课程,但这并不意味着学习C语言没有价值。对于有特定需求或对底层编程感兴趣的学员来说,学习C语言仍然是有益的。此外,对于想要深入理解计算机工作原理和底层机制的学员来说,学习C语言可以提供更深入的知识和理解。因此,对于那些有特定需求或对底层编程感兴趣的人来说,他们可以选择其他资源(如在线教程或自学)来学习C语言。
1年前 -